Output 23dd0c8e89737f5ae8814054274a0c428a79b9defbdafc56111efa48a5c3793e:1

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a04d56ab741fb3007474f1f45fadce8c0b7108a OP_EQUAL
address
3FjPmw8tRhSqsRH9grkiQDSKVe4uw9LZcW
transaction
23dd0c8e89737f5ae8814054274a0c428a79b9defbdafc56111efa48a5c3793e
confirmations
358051
spent
true